ANTH-B 111: INTRODUCTION TO CHIMPANZEE BEHAVIOR AND COGNITION (3 credits)

About

Surveys research on the behavior and cognition of our closest relative, the chimpanzee. Areas covered include the discovery of the chimpanzee, diet, foraging behavior, parenting, hunting, intelligence, psychology, language/communication, sleep science, tool-making and using activity, aggression, sex, social system and what chimpanzees tell us about human evolution.
